PPI for the electricity sector in the four quarter ending June 21 decreased by 2.18%, according to data reported by the Statistical Center of Iran.
The importance of PPI lies in its predictive content for the future pattern of Consumer Price Index. Changes in PPI are usually reflected in CPI within a short period of time.
PPI gauges the price fluctuations of goods and services for the producer whereas CPI measures changes in the price level of a basket of consumer goods and services purchased by households, Financial Tribune reported.
